Postby Keith » Sun Jun 05, 2011 7:45 pm

[quote]
The reason for my letter is that we have also had increased reports of anti social and inconsiderate cycling, in particular complaints about groups of cyclists blocking roads by cycling in "pelotons".


I too have seen some anti-social and inconsiderate cycling. I have also seen at least equal amounts of anti-social and inconsiderate driving. Being a regular Surrey driver, I've yet to receive a similar letter from the police regarding this.

One issue I have is with in particular complaints about groups of cyclists blocking roads by cycling in "pelotons". A group of two abreast cyclists is indeed a peloton, but how is this blocking roads? Since when did motorists have priority over cyclists? Any car driver wishing to overtake simply has to await a safe opportunity to do so. On a narrow country lane, a motorist may have to be patient for a number of minutes. Perhaps us cyclists don't appreciate just how important these complaining car drivers are?
We as a club, could probably be more considerate to others in the size of groups that tend to form on the way back from the cafe though. This can make it difficult to overtake safely for a fair distance.

Postby Phil H » Sun Jun 05, 2011 10:48 pm

Sorry guys, but I've re-read the policeman's letter and I can't see the bit where he claims that motorists never commit offences - in fact it doesn't seem to specifically mention motorists at all so I can't see the relevance of bringing them into the discussion. Nor can I see the bit where he says that riding two abreast is not allowed - in fact it seems to say the opposite to me.

What PC Cox appears to be saying is "Don't be an inconsiderate d1ck". And the responses are "yeah but motorists do this and that". As I said the letter isn't about motorists. It's like saying "Well, let's ignore bike theft because what Hitler did was much worse".

(And thus he invoked Godwin's law, and left)

PS: I think a public safety film campaign pointing out how to drive around cyclists might be helpful. There are some drivers out there who are beyond education though.

Postby the other Steve Dennis » Mon Jun 06, 2011 1:13 am

I know I am not an active member over in the Surrey lanes anymore but it is worth noting that he sent you a letter of advice - no matter what can be read between the lines. Over here there are communities which have banned cycling on the main roads through their towns, where more than 2 abreast is very illegal and where it is enforced regularly. Not to mention the b$strds in NYC who actively set up speed traps and camp out at intersections waiting to clothesline any cyclist committing a minor infraction.

I had the thought that the police are very aware of the coming RR and want to keep it. If for any reason the unreasonable elements of the communities through which the RR passes decide to kick up a fuss it is possible the course would be changed. Maybe he is trying to pre-empt issues.

One of many solutions could be to create signage along the 'trafficed' areas of the course that highlight it is part of the course for 2012 and to stress the importance of 'sharing the road' as more cyclists are using these areas. Maybe part of the cost could be carried by 'sponsoring' clubs of Surrey?

Anyway - enjoy the hills and the rain. It's as flat and windy as hell here in the Midwest.
